Understanding Randle's Scoring Style
So, what exactly makes Julius Randle's scoring so effective, you ask? Well, it's a combination of things, really. First off, his physicality is a massive advantage. He's built like a truck, and when he gets into the paint, defenders often find themselves in a tough spot. He uses his strength to power through contact, drawing fouls and getting easy buckets near the rim. But he's not just a brute force player; he's got finesse too. He can finish with both hands, has a decent hook shot, and has developed a respectable floater game. Another key aspect is his shooting ability. Over the years, Randle has worked hard on his three-point shot. While it might not be Stephen Curry-level consistency, he can absolutely knock down open threes, which forces defenders to extend their coverage and opens up driving lanes. This versatility is crucial. Teams can't just sag off him expecting him to miss from deep, and they can't just crowd the paint for fear of him driving. This forces difficult defensive decisions. Furthermore, his rebounding prowess often leads to second-chance points. He's a monster on the boards, and when he grabs an offensive rebound, he often has a good opportunity to score right back up. His court vision also plays a role; he's not just looking to score himself. He can find open teammates when double-teamed, but when the opportunity arises, he's not afraid to take over and get his own. His footwork in the post has also improved, allowing him to create space against smaller defenders. When you combine all these elements – strength, improved shooting, post moves, and rebounding – you get a complete offensive package that makes him incredibly difficult to guard. He’s a guy who can score from anywhere on the court, and that’s what makes watching him play so exciting for fans who appreciate a well-rounded offensive game. Impact of His Scoring on Team Success
Guys, it's not just about the individual numbers when Julius Randle scores; it's about how his scoring directly impacts his team's success. A player who can consistently put the ball in the basket is invaluable, and Randle is a prime example of this. When he's on fire, the entire team benefits. His ability to draw double teams, for instance, opens up opportunities for his teammates. Defenders have to collapse on him, leaving shooters open on the perimeter or cutters free to the basket. This creates a ripple effect, making the whole offense more fluid and harder to defend. During his All-Star seasons, we saw a direct correlation between his scoring output and his team's winning record. He became the focal point of the offense, carrying the load and often being the primary reason for their victories. His scoring provides a much-needed offensive spark, especially during tough stretches of a game where the team might be struggling to find a rhythm. He can create his own shot, which is crucial in late-game situations when a team needs a crucial basket. This reliability in clutch moments is a testament to his confidence and skill. Furthermore, his aggressive scoring style often leads to free throws, which not only add points to the scoreboard but also put pressure on the opposing team's defense and help manage the game's tempo. When Randle gets to the line, he's often effective, turning defensive pressure into offensive points. His scoring also boosts team morale.
